Mount Olive Cools Off Softball

MOUNT OLIVE – Mount Olive used timely hitting and recorded 20 hits on the way to a twinbill sweep over the UNC Pembroke softball team on Saturday afternoon at Cassell Field. 
 
Both teams tacked on runs in the opening frame, and UNCP had bases loaded in the top of the seventh but was unable to capitalized as the Trojans took the first game 4-1. Mount Olive scored multiple runs in three of the five innings to secure an 8-0 victory over the Braves in five innings. 
 
The setback snapped a six-game conference winning streak for the Braves (16-25, 9-7 CC) who fall to 1-15 when playing away from Pembroke. The Trojans (23-15, 12-6 CC) have now won three out of the last four meetings with the Black & Gold and are 19-9 when playing at home.

KEY INNINGS (GAME 1)
TOP 1 UNC Pembroke loaded the bases after a pair of walks from Cirstin Calloway and Samantha Allred, as well as Lauren Hilbourn reaching via hit by pitch. An ill-timed wild pitched scored Calloway to give UNCP an early 1-0 lead.
BOT 1 Courtlynn Cooney beat out an infield single and advanced to second after a sacrifice bunt. Kylie Emanuele singled down the right field line to score Cooney. Mount Olive loaded the bases a hit by pitch, a walk and a single, but a single to the right center field gap drove in two runs and gave the Trojans a 4-1 lead. 
KEY INNINGS (GAME 2)
BOT 1 Courtlynn Cooney singled to the pitcher on a bunt and advanced to second on a sacrifice bunt. Cana Shrock beat out an infield single and then stole second to put runners on second and third. A double down the left field line from Kylie Emanuele drove in both runners to give Mount Olive the lead for good.
